  Ocean Bay, a subsidiary of Three Saints Bay, LLC, and a Federal Government Contractor industry leader, is seeking a Data Analyst I

  POSITION RESPONSIBILITIES:

  Maintain information in all MegaCenter systems to include but not limited to:

  Buildings:

  Validate/maintain information for all GSA provided through a reliable source (GSA building management, FPS Law Enforcement, etc.) including:

  Physical Building information

  Emergency and non-emergency contacts

  FPS LESO

  Local Responders

  Guard Posts

  Occupant Agencies

  Elevators

  Amenities

  Update building profiles with special instructions regarding emergency and non-emergency events to assist dispatching operations.

  Projects:

  Validate Local Responders

  Guard Post Updates

  Contact clean up

  Call list project

  Verify and complete the addition and removal of buildings in the MegaCenter information system using the weekly GSA Rexus

  Alarm Accounts:

  Validate/Maintain information on all alarm accounts, to include physical demographics, local responders, government agency contacts, zones, and panel information.

  Document alarm account notes/instructions/procedures in the appropriate areas in an alarm account profile.

  Create and delete accounts in the required MegaCenter system(s).

  Maintain hard copies of all alarm accounts as a backup to the alarm monitoring system to comply with UL certification requirements.

  Prepare alarm reports for government agency contacts and FPS Personnel.

  Receive, complete, and respond to alarm and/or account inquiries from government agency contacts using service requests as a tracking tool in the MegaCenter information system.

  Contact government agency contacts for current information regarding alarm and building accounts.

  Contacts:

  Validate and update information within officer and contact profiles in the MegaCenter information system.

  Perform quality assurance for:

  Overall accuracy of all MegaCenter information systems.

  Dispatcher Events:

  Validate times for dispatcher events

  Exclude times in dispatcher events for delayed calls, assist in providing information management support to include but not limited to project management services.

  Send quality review emails to the dispatch center if a change to an event is required.

  Research events to identify third party alarm building discrepancies

  MegaCenter correspondence (including Spot Reports, Flag Notification, Daily Blotter, etc.)

  Maintain all tracking and logging tools providing statistical data in the MegaCenter information system.

  Log FPS and MegaCenter operational stats on a daily basis using events in the Dispatch

  Operations Log. Create, document, and disseminate reports upon request to FPS Headquarters personnel, FPS Regional personnel, MegaCenter Management.

  Create, edit, or delete accounts in the current MegaCenter system.

  Maintain hard copies of all alarm accounts as a backup to the alarm monitoring system to comply with UL certification requirements.

  Maintain a level of expert knowledge of the MegaCenter information systems.

  Assist in providing training to personnel on the operations of each system to include, but not limited to: Alarm Monitoring Software, WebRMS/LEIMS or other information management software, MIST, MegaN

  Provide recommendations to other departments in the MegaCenter on how to use each system listed above effectively and efficiently.

  POSITION REQUIREMENTS:

  High School diploma or GED

  Computer Skills – Utilizes a personal computer with word processing, spreadsheet and related software with reasonable speed and accuracy.

  Proficient in Word, Excel, and data entry
